Onboarding note — door sensor recall, Stratby Office. The Corvex-9 door sensors on Levels 1–3 are being recalled; replacements arrive in stages over the next three weeks. Affected doors will not auto-release, so team assistants must badge visitors through manually and log each entry on the shared sheet. Do not prop doors open. Technicians from Fenwright Controls handle swaps on Tuesdays. The temporary override code for affected doors is below.

turnstile pass: bdg-FVNQRS-72965873

The proposed training budget for next year holds overall spend flat while shifting allocation toward compliance and fleet-safety modules at the Eldermere depot. Leadership development moves to an internal cohort model, reducing external facilitation costs by roughly a quarter. Department heads have reviewed draft allocations; two disputes remain open regarding the Quayside team's certification track. Final figures go to the board in March. The strategic rationale is recorded confidentially below.

board note of kafog-bajep: Briathek Partners is in early talks to buy Aldaelek Group for about $47.1 million. The Ulaath launch date is September 4, and nothing goes to the press before then.

Release checklist — RateMirror parity checker, step 7: Confirm the crawler honors the per-partner throttle table before enabling the Lumetta hotel group feed. Run the dry-run comparison against staging tariffs and verify zero false parity violations over a 15-minute window. Once the dry run passes, record the verified build token shown below.

pipeline stamp: htk9_ce63042d9